A parasitic fly that consumes living flesh has been detected within 25 miles of the United States border, prompting federal investigators to examine a suspected case in a Texas calf — the closest brush with domestic soil in nearly a year. The New World screwworm, once eradicated from the U.S. through a decades-long campaign, has been advancing northward through Central America and Mexico with quiet persistence, and its arrival now feels less like a distant possibility than an approaching threshold. Geopolitical Impact
A potential New World screwworm case in Texas, following detection 25 miles away in Mexico, represents a biosecurity threat requiring coordinated U.S.-Mexico agricultural response.
This is primarily a public health and agricultural issue rather than a geopolitical power struggle. However, it underscores U.S. dependence on Mexican cooperation for disease surveillance and control, requiring bilateral coordination between USDA and Mexican agricultural authorities. The incident highlights the interconnected nature of North American agricultural systems and the need for cross-border institutional cooperation.
Similar to the 1960s-1980s screwworm eradication campaign in the U.S., which required sustained international cooperation with Mexico and Central America through the Sterile Insect Technique (SIT). The current resurgence in Mexico after decades of control demonstrates how disease containment requires continuous binational effort.
